INTRODUCTION In view of the envisaged competitive electricity market era, utilities are examining the application of information technology (IT) as an alternative to support corporate business strategies that focus on improving service, power quality and reducing cost of operation and maintenance. Key issues for the improvement of the overall productivity are more and better information concerning the entire system behaviour, service condition of physical assets, e.g. circuit breakers and power transformers, as well as cost efficient operation and maintenance management. In the increasingly competitive arena there is significant pressure on power providers for greater system reliability and improvement of customer satisfaction, while similar emphasis is placed on cost reduction. These cost reductions focus on reducing operating and maintenance (O&M) expenses, and minimizing investments in new plants and equipment. If plant investments are to be made only for that which is absolutely necessary and the existing system equipment must be pushed to greater limits in order to defer capital investments. Substation Automation (SA) in comparison with a remote terminal (RTU) concept means decentralisation of computer capacity, which shall be used e.g. for intelligent automatic power restoration procedures after faults and for powerful decentralised processing of service and environment condition related data. Utility executives, on the other hand, are increasingly examining automation solution alternatives to support corporate business strategies that focus on improving service reliability and reducing cost of operation and maintenance. In the past, utility engineers often struggled with the fact that too little data was available when they attempted to analyze problems within their power systems. They also did not have enough information to predict or ascertain the level of maintenance needed of when it would be required for the major equipment located within their substations. As new and higher levels of digital technologies have made its way into substations in terms of numerical protection devices and control systems, these same engineers are suffering from data overload. They have more data than can be processed and assimilated in the time available. Today the challenge is to automatically convert data to knowledge, which frees manpower to implement corrective or preventive maintenance. It is suggested that intelligent electronic devices (IED) shall be implemented for protection and control tasks in substations to substitute electro-mechanical or static devices. In a modern SA system theses IEDs provide an infrastructure to collect, to process and to transmit data and information, which are utilised for cost effective condition monitoring of circuit breakers, power transformers, instrument transformers etc. This idea is illustrated by an example for power transformer condition monitoring. The SA system provides a user-friendly overview for the actual transformer condition. This comprises condition-related parameters like: service current, temperatures, and quality of insulation oil, partial discharge measurements and loads. WORKING PLANTS HARDER The integration of the various SA systems in a high performance communication network allows system wide adaptive protection and real time automatic power restoration procedures Various aspects of the utilities needs have been revealed in the Cigré 99 London Symposium on the subject: “Working Plant and Systems harder”. Enhancing the management and performance of plant and power systems is being discussed widely at many international conferences. The overall conclusion perceived is that there are a lot of new technologies available, which will help planners and operators to find new solutions to maximise the use of the power systems and adapt to the fast changing environment.
